Odd one out vocabulary
Exclude
To leave out; to keep from being a part of.
Alleviate
To make (something, such as pain or suffering) more bearable; to partially remove or correct. Relive or lessen
Equity
Treating people with fairness with fairness and justice
Trepidation
a feeling of fear or agitation about something that may happen
Multitude
a great number of things or people
Epitome
a person or thing that is a perfect example of a particular quality or type
Assumption
a thing that is accepted as true or as certain to happen, without proof.
Resurgence
an increase or revival after a period of little activity, popularity, or occurrence.
Suffice
be enough or adequate
Inevitable
certain to happen; unavoidable
Nonchalant
cool and confident, unconcerned
Audacity
excessive boldness, or daring with confident or disregard for personal safety or other restrictions.
Loathe
feel intense dislike or disgust for
Wary
feeling or showing caution about possible dangers or problems
Perilous
full of danger or risk
Livid
furiously angry
Sinister
giving the impression that something harmful or evil is happening or will happen
Dehumanize
Deprive of human qualities; to treat as if less than a person
Bias
prejudice in favor of or against one thing, person, or group compared with another, usually in a way considered to be unfair.
Empathy
the ability to understand and share the feelings of another
